Commit 0ef8faff490be ("fs: push nr_cached_objects memcg gating into
individual filesystems") was meant to drop the blanket memcg gate in
fs/super.c and let each ->nr_cached_objects() implementation decide
for itself whether it is meaningful in per-memcg reclaim. However,
when that patch was applied the removal of super_fs_objects_eligible()
and its two call sites in super_cache_scan() / super_cache_count() was
lost, so the helper is still gating every ->nr_cached_objects() hook
and 0ef8faff490be is effectively a no-op.
Consequences of the leftover gate:
- XFS's inode-reclaim hook, which is intentionally driven from
per-memcg contexts to free memcg-charged slab, is still
short-circuited in fs/super.c — exactly the regression from
commit 0baad6f9b997 ("fs/super: skip non-memcg-aware
nr_cached_objects in memcg slab shrink") that 0ef8faff490be was
written to undo. Memcg-charged XFS inode slab therefore keeps
piling up under per-memcg pressure until global reclaim kicks in.
- Any future ->nr_cached_objects()/->free_cached_objects() that
grows memcg awareness is likewise blocked before it can run, so
filesystems cannot opt in to per-memcg reclaim on their own —
defeating the whole point of pushing the gating decision down
into the callbacks.
Drop the leftover helper and its call sites so the intent of
0ef8faff490be actually takes effect.
Fixes: 0ef8faff490be ("fs: push nr_cached_objects memcg gating into
individual filesystems")
Cc: stable@vger.kernel.org
